I have been searching around the internet to find a solution for a file/premiere pro error. Sorry if I don't use the right terminology, I am not very tech-savvy. Here is the issue I am facing. Every time I enter the audio workspace (premiere pro 25), I am no longer able to find the Audio-match button and the audio presets are gone. I can only do a limited amount of audio things. I looked it up and they said to delete my user preferences through documents>Adobe>Premiere pro>25.0>Profile-'user'>Settings [windows version]. The problem is I cannot find these files. I go to documents>Adobe> and all I find is Adobe Media Encoder. When I go to create a new project on Premiere Pro, this is the path it defaults to but I am not able to save there and get prompted with this error. So I save my projects to a different pathway and continue importing. Once I am in my project I get this error. I have uninstalled and reinstalled Adobe Creative Cloud, Premiere Pro and all other apps. I cannot find a solution to this anywhere and would really appreciate if someone could help me out. I have done the %appdata% and tried other pathways to find Premiere pro>25.0>Profile-'user'>Settings and I am having no luck. It's like these files just vanished and no matter what I do I cannot fix them. Please let me know if you need any other information and I can try and find it.
